A folded food carton is formed from a matable, lay flat blank for retaining, transporting and serving hot food such as pizza. The blank includes an arrangement of end panels, side panels and cover panels foldable relative to a bottom panel such that, in the erected carton, the cover panels overlap and are interlocked with the side panels by means of offset locking tabs. The end panels slant upwardly and inwardly from the bottom panel to add rigidity and save material for the carton. The side panels flare upwardly and outwardly from the bottom panel and extend above the cover panels to enhance stackability and prevent shifting of stacked cartons one on top of the other. Several methods of packaging pizza in the folded carton are disclosed.

We claim: 1. A pizza box formed from an integral blank of material, the pizza box comprising: a substantially flat and rectangular bottom panel; a pair of opposed end panels and a pair of opposed, first transverse fold lines, each end panel being hingedly joined to the bottom panel along its respective first transverse fold line; a pair of opposed cover panels and a pair of opposed, second transverse fold lines, each cover panel being bingedly joined to its respective end panel along its respective second transverse fold line, each cover panel having opposed longitudinal edges, and each cover panel having a set of opposed locking tabs extending outwardly from the longitudinal edges; a pair of side panels hingedly joined to the bottom panel along a pair of opposed longitudinal fold lines, each side panel having openings for frictionally receiving the locking tabs on the cover panels; and, wherein the pizza box is foldable along the fold lines into a closed position by folding the side panels, end panels and cover panels, the cover panels being generally parallel to the bottom panel, overlapping each other and interlocking with the side panels via the locking tabs, the end panels slanting inwardly and upwardly relative to the bottom panel, the side panels slanting outwardly and upwardly relative to the bottom panel, and the side panels extending above the cover panels. 2. The pizza box of claim 1, wherein each end panel has opposed side edges diverging outwardly from ends of the first transverse fold lines to ends of the second transverse fold lines, the end panels are trapezoidal in shape. 3. The pizza box of claim 1, wherein the side edges of each side panel extend at an acute angle relative to the second transverse fold lines. 4. The pizza box of claim 1, wherein each cover panel is substantially rectangular and each locking tab is formed with a pair of outwardly diverging edges and a pair of outwardly extending, converging edges. 5. The pizza box of claim 1, wherein the locking tabs on each cover panel are offset with at least one of said locking tabs lying adjacent the second transverse fold line and the other one of said locking tabs being positioned adjacent an outer end of the cover panel. 6. The pizza box of claim 1, wherein the longitudinal fold lines lie parallel to a longitudinal axis passing through the bottom panel, and the first and second transverse lines lie parallel to each other and transverse to the longitudinal axis. 7. The pizza box of claim 1, wherein each side panel is formed with a contoured outer edge, a pair of shoulders and a pair of side edges disposed at acute angles relative to one of the longitudinal fold lines. 8. The pizza box of claim 7, wherein the contoured outer edge include a pair of spaced apart extended portions and a pair of spaced apart recesses, the extended portions and recesses on one side panel being offset relative to the extended portions and recesses on the opposite side panel. 9. The pizza box of claim 8, wherein the openings formed in each side panel lie inwardly of the extended portions. 10. The pizza box of claim 1, wherein the openings are sized to permit venting of a hot food product packaged in the pizza box. 11. The pizza box of claim 1, wherein upon folding the end panels, the side panels and the cover panels, the end panels are oriented at an acute angle relative to the bottom panel. 12. The pizza box of claim 1, wherein upon folding the end panels, the side panels and the cover panels, the side panels are oriented at an obtuse angle relative to the bottom panel. 13. The pizza box of claim 1, wherein the outwardly-slanting side panels facilitate vertical stacking of other pizza boxes one on top of the other and define guides to prevent side-to-side shifting of the other pizza boxes stacked upon the cover panels. 14. The pizza box of claim 1, wherein the end panels are substantially trapezoidal in shape. 15. The pizza box of claim 1, wherein each end panel has opposed side edges diverging outwardly from ends of the first transverse fold lines to ends of the second transverse fold lines. 16. The pizza box of claim 1, wherein each cover panel is substantially rectangular. 17. The pizza box of claim 1, wherein each locking tab is formed with a pair of outwardly diverging edges and a pair of outwardly extending, converging edges.
